University of Guelph Overview

The University of Guelph, located in Ontario, Canada, is a comprehensive public research university established in 1964. It is known for its commitment to life sciences, agriculture, veterinary sciences, environmental studies, and strong interdisciplinary programs. The campus offers a blend of academic excellence, vibrant student life, and a strong focus on innovation and sustainability.

University of Guelph Tuition Fees

Program LevelTuition Fees (CAD/year)
Undergraduate (Domestic)$6,100 – $7,500
Undergraduate (International)$28,000 – $38,000
Graduate (Domestic)$6,500 – $9,000
Graduate (International)$14,000 – $21,000
Doctor of Veterinary Medicine (International)$70,000+

University of Guelph Cost of Living

Guelph offers a relatively affordable cost of living compared to other major Canadian cities. The city provides excellent amenities, transportation, and student discounts, making it student-friendly.

Expense CategoryEstimated Monthly Cost (CAD)
Accommodation$600 – $1,200
Food$300 – $500
Transportation$60 – $100
Books/Supplies$80 – $150
Personal Expenses$150 – $300

University of Guelph Online Application

Applications for undergraduate programs are submitted through the Ontario Universities’ Application Centre (OUAC). Graduate program applications are submitted directly via the University of Guelph’s online graduate portal, with program-specific deadlines and requirements.
